  • The Mississippi Center for Justice (“MCJ”) seeks a dynamic Communications and Graphic Design Specialist (“CGDS”) who excels in crafting captivating visual narratives and possesses the vision to unify our work graphically, effectively conveying our story and mission. While PR and communications are essential components of this role, the emphasis is on leveraging graphic design skills to enhance our mission-driven work focused on racial, economic, and social justice.

    MCJ is a nonprofit, public interest law firm committed to advancing racial, economic, and social justice statewide. Our lawyers work with community leaders to support their social justice campaigns and to channel the energies of the legal community to combat discrimination and poverty. With offices in Jackson, Biloxi, and Indianola, we seek systemic solutions that support a fair and just criminal justice system for juveniles and adults, protect the rights of consumers, secure access to healthcare, protect voting rights for all, and make fair and affordable housing available for all Mississippians.

    Position Summary

    The Communications and Graphic Design Specialist will report to the Director of Communications. The CGDS will be instrumental in crafting and executing our internal and external communications strategies, brand identity, and visual content. This role demands creativity, attention to detail,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ment, collaborating closely with the Director of Communications across PR, graphic design, event planning, and administrative communications.

Mississippi is bordered to the north by Tennessee, to the east by Alabama, to the south by Louisiana and a narrow coast on the Gulf of Mexico; and to the west, across the Mississippi River, by Louisiana and Arkansas. In addition to its namesake, major rivers in Mississippi include the Big Black River, the Pearl River, the Yazoo River, the Pascagoula River, and the Tombigbee River. Major lakes include Ross Barnett Reservoir, Arkabutla Lake, Sardis Lake, and Grenada Lake with the largest lake being Sardis Lake.
